: The episode begins with Goku finally escaping the bizarre "game world" of Sugoro Space with the help of Kibito Kai. This subplot, while often criticized for its slow pace, finally concludes here, allowing the narrative to return to the high stakes of the Baby invasion.

: On Earth, the atmosphere is effectively eerie. Baby has used the Black Star Dragon Balls to recreate Planet Plant (New Planet Plant) and has successfully brainwashed almost the entire human population.
